é inclinado

[ɛ ĩ.kli.ˈna.du]
verb phrase (present indicative of 'ser' + adjective)N/A (verb phrase)
is inclined, is bent, is sloped, is tilted
1. To be in a slanted, tilted, or angled position
The tower is inclined to one side.
A torre é inclinada para um lado.
2. To be disposed or having a tendency toward something
He is inclined to agree with the proposal.
Ele é inclinado a concordar com a proposta.
3. To be prone or susceptible to something
She is inclined to worry too much.
Ela é inclinada a se preocupar demais.
